.fcard[data-astro-cid-lb4otonv]{display:grid;grid-template-columns:1.05fr 1fr;background:var(--card);border:1px solid var(--line);border-radius:var(--radius);overflow:hidden;box-shadow:var(--shadow-card);transition:transform .2s ease}.fcard[data-astro-cid-lb4otonv]:hover{transform:translateY(-4px)}.fcov[data-astro-cid-lb4otonv]{background:#0c2a1d;position:relative;min-height:300px;overflow:hidden}.fcov[data-astro-cid-lb4otonv] img[data-astro-cid-lb4otonv]{position:absolute;inset:0;width:100%;height:100%;object-fit:cover;display:block}.badge[data-astro-cid-lb4otonv]{position:absolute;top:18px;left:18px;background:var(--jade-bright);color:#04240f;font-weight:700;font-size:.74rem;letter-spacing:.08em;text-transform:uppercase;padding:7px 13px;border-radius:var(--radius-pill);z-index:2}.fbody[data-astro-cid-lb4otonv]{padding:42px;display:flex;flex-direction:column;justify-content:center}.pcat[data-astro-cid-lb4otonv]{font-size:.74r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--jade-deep);margin-bottom:12px}.fbody[data-astro-cid-lb4otonv] h2[data-astro-cid-lb4otonv]{font-size:clamp(1.7rem,2.8vw,2.3rem);margin-bottom:14px}.fbody[data-astro-cid-lb4otonv] p[data-astro-cid-lb4otonv]{color:var(--ink-soft);margin-bottom:24px;font-size:1.05rem}.pauthor[data-astro-cid-lb4otonv]{display:flex;align-items:center;gap:11px}.ai[data-astro-cid-lb4otonv] b[data-astro-cid-lb4otonv]{font-size:.9rem;font-weight:700;display:block;line-height:1.15}.ai[data-astro-cid-lb4otonv] small[data-astro-cid-lb4otonv]{font-size:.8rem;color:var(--ink-soft)}@media(max-width:980px){.fcard[data-astro-cid-lb4otonv]{grid-template-columns:1fr}.fcov[data-astro-cid-lb4otonv]{min-height:200px}}@media(max-width:620px){.fbody[data-astro-cid-lb4otonv]{padding:28px}}.crumb[data-astro-cid-vnrdjxtv]{padding-top:18px}.blog-head[data-astro-cid-vnrdjxtv]{padding:34px 0 8px;text-align:center;max-width:680px;margin:0 auto}.blog-head[data-astro-cid-vnrdjxtv] .eyebrow{margin-bottom:22px}.blog-head[data-astro-cid-vnrdjxtv] h1[data-astro-cid-vnrdjxtv]{font-size:clamp(2.4rem,5vw,3.7rem);font-weight:600;margin-bottom:16px}.blog-head[data-astro-cid-vnrdjxtv] p[data-astro-cid-vnrdjxtv]{font-size:1.18rem;color:var(--ink-soft)}.filters[data-astro-cid-vnrdjxtv]{display:flex;gap:10px;justify-content:center;flex-wrap:wrap;margin:30px 0 8px}.fpill[data-astro-cid-vnrdjxtv]{font-family:var(--font-sans);font-weight:600;font-size:.94rem;padding:10px 18px;border-radius:var(--radius-pill);border:1.5px solid var(--line);background:var(--card);color:var(--ink-soft);cursor:pointer;transition:border-color .16s ease,color .16s ease,background .16s ease}.fpill[data-astro-cid-vnrdjxtv]:hover{border-color:var(--mint-line);color:var(--ink)}.fpill[data-astro-cid-vnrdjxtv].active{background:var(--jade);border-color:var(--jade);color:#fff;box-shadow:0 10px 22px -10px #0b845799}.featured[data-astro-cid-vnrdjxtv]{margin-top:30px}.listing[data-astro-cid-vnrdjxtv]{padding-top:30px;padding-bottom:80px}.grid[data-astro-cid-vnrdjxtv]{display:grid;grid-template-columns:repeat(3,1fr);gap:22px}.empty[data-astro-cid-vnrdjxtv]{display:none;text-align:center;color:var(--ink-soft);padding:60px 0;font-size:1.05rem}.pager[data-astro-cid-vnrdjxtv]{display:flex;justify-content:center;align-items:center;gap:4px;flex-wrap:wrap;margin-top:44px}.pager[data-astro-cid-vnrdjxtv]:empty{display:none}.pager[data-astro-cid-vnrdjxtv] .pg{display:inline-flex;align-items:center;justify-content:center;min-width:32px;height:32px;padding:0 8px;font-family:var(--font-sans);font-weight:600;font-size:.88rem;border-radius:8px;border:none;background:none;color:var(--ink-soft);cursor:pointer;transition:color .15s ease,background .15s ease}.pager[data-astro-cid-vnrdjxtv] .pg:hover:not(:disabled){color:var(--jade-deep);background:var(--mint)}.pager[data-astro-cid-vnrdjxtv] .pg.active{color:var(--jade-deep);font-weight:700}.pager[data-astro-cid-vnrdjxtv] .pg:disabled{opacity:.3;cursor:not-allowed}.pager[data-astro-cid-vnrdjxtv] .pg-gap{display:inline-flex;align-items:center;justify-content:center;min-width:20px;height:32px;color:var(--ink-soft)}@media(max-width:980px){.grid[data-astro-cid-vnrdjxtv]{grid-template-columns:1fr 1fr}}@media(max-width:620px){.grid[data-astro-cid-vnrdjxtv]{grid-template-columns:1fr}}
